Erwin Angerer (born December 30, 1964 in Mühldorf, Carinthia) is an Austrian politician for the Freedom Party (FPÖ). He is also part of the Council in Schrems, Chairman of the Social Democratic Trade Unionists of the district of Gmünd and chairman of the SPÖ local organization Lower Schrems.

Political Career[edit]

Angerer started his political career in 1999 in the Austrian town of Gmünd, where he became the Chairman of the local group. In 2001, he was elected local Chairman of the Social Democratic Party of Austria (SPÖ) in Schrems. In 2009, he became the district chairman of the SPÖ in Gmünd. He has been a member of the Lower Austrian Landtag from 2008 till 2013. Angerer has been a Member of Parliament since July 2, 2014.
